The Ordinary Hyaluronic Acid 2% + B5 with Ceramides is a lightweight serum designed for anyone battling dry skin or seeking enhanced hydration. It targets all skin types, especially dry and sensitive ones, by penetrating multiple skin layers to deliver moisture and support the barrier function.

Key features include a 2% hyaluronic acid complex for multi-depth hydration, vitamin B5 for surface soothing, and ceramides to reinforce the skin's protective layer. Users report plumper, smoother skin after one week, with sustained benefits over four weeks. It layers seamlessly under creams or with actives like squalane or glycolic acid.

The water-based formula is alcohol-free, oil-free, and silicone-free, making it non-comedogenic and easy to incorporate into daily routines. Its simple packaging ensures straightforward application morning and night post-cleansing.

Potential drawbacks include the need for a patch test on sensitive skin and a possible tacky feel if too much is used. It lacks immediate dramatic changes for very dehydrated skin without consistent use.

Overall, this serum excels as an affordable hydration powerhouse, earning high praise for real results. Ideal for building a solid skincare foundation.

La Roche-Posay Hyalu B5 Pure Hyaluronic Acid Serum is designed for anyone seeking intense hydration and anti-aging benefits, especially those with sensitive skin. This oil-free formula combines pure hyaluronic acid, vitamin B5, and madecassoside to visibly plump and repair the skin, addressing age-related moisture loss that leads to fine lines and dullness.

Standout features include its ability to hold up to 1000 times its weight in water, delivering deep hydration when applied to damp skin, ideally after misting with Thermal Spring Water. In real-world use, it absorbs quickly into a rich serum texture, pairing perfectly with cleansers, moisturizers, and SPF in a complete routine for morning and night application across all skin types.

The build quality reflects La Roche-Posay's dermatologist-backed standards, with a gentle, non-irritating composition safe for sensitive skin. It integrates into step 2 of skincare routines after cleansing, before moisturizing, offering a lightweight feel without residue.

Potential drawbacks include the need to follow with a moisturizer to seal in benefits and optimal results on damp skin, which adds a step. For very dry skin, it might require layering.

Overall, Hyalu B5 earns high marks for effective plumping hydration and repair, making it a solid choice for anti-aging skincare routines.

Buying Guide: Choose Your Match

Hydration Depth vs. Surface Slick

Low-molecular HA sinks deep for all-day plumpness, ideal if dehydration hits below the surface—like post-flight tightness—but high doses can pull moisture from air, leaving a tacky film in low-humidity rooms. The Ordinary’s 2% mix crosses layers fast on normal skin, outpacing single-weight options, yet it balls up under thick creams.

For drier profiles, La Roche-Posay Hyalu B5 layers B5 for repair, holding hydration 24 hours longer than basic HA, though it costs more upfront. Skip pure HA if your routine lacks a humectant lock-in moisturizer.

Skin Type Fit and Irritation Risk

Oily skins thrive on lightweight gels like Good Molecules’ 1%—absorbs in seconds without shine—but underequipped for mature dehydration needing barrier boost. Sensitive types favor Vichy Mineral 89’s mineral base, calming redness better than ceramide-heavy rivals, at the trade-off of milder plumping.

Neutrogena’s night-pressed version revitalizes overnight for combo skin, gentler than actives but slower visible glow. Test patch if eczema-prone; fragrance-free doesn’t always mean irritation-free.

Extras That Amplify (or Complicate)

Boosters like madecassoside in La Roche-Posay heal faster post-retinol, edging out plain HA for irritated skin—but add $10-20 versus stripped formulas. Ceramides in The Ordinary seal better in winter, trading instant slip for longevity. Avoid overload if layering with acids; dilution weakens pulls.

Pure HA shines solo mornings; skip add-ins if minimalism rules your routine. Retinol users, prioritize soothing pairs.

Absorption Speed vs. Staying Power

Watery textures like Good Molecules vanish instantly for makeup prep, but evaporate quicker sans occlusion—fine for humid climates, frustrating in dry ones. Thicker ones like ALASTIN Immerse cling for glow, ideal for mature skin, yet feel heavy midday.

Decision: Morning lightweight, night rich. Compare to your moisturizer; mismatch causes pilling.

Price-to-Plump Ratio

Under $10 steals like Good Molecules match $30 hydration short-term, but fade faster long-term versus La Roche-Posay’s repair edge. Luxury like ALASTIN ($134) glows radiantly, worth it for events, skippable for daily grind.

FAQs

Can I use hyaluronic acid serum every day?

Yes, AM/PM over clean skin—but always seal with moisturizer, or it backfires in dry air. Build routines around it.

Does hyaluronic acid clog pores?

Rarely in gel forms; water-based like our picks suit oily skins best. Creamier ones risk it on acne-prone.

Which is better: 1% or 2% hyaluronic acid?

2% penetrates deeper for plumper results, but 1% gentler for beginners—test tolerance.

How long until I see results?

Immediate bounce, full plump in 1-2 weeks. Consistent layering accelerates.
